Subject: [PATCH 5.14 028/125] ftrace/nds32: Update the proto for ftrace_trace_function to match ftrace_stub

From: Steven Rostedt (VMware) <rostedt@...dmis.org>

commit 4e84dc47bb48accbbeeba4e6bb3f31aa7895323c upstream.

The ftrace callback prototype was changed to pass a special ftrace_regs
instead of pt_regs as the last parameter, but the static ftrace for nds32
missed updating ftrace_trace_function and this caused a warning when
compared to ftrace_stub:

../arch/nds32/kernel/ftrace.c: In function '_mcount':
../arch/nds32/kernel/ftrace.c:24:35: error: comparison of distinct pointer types lacks a cast [-Werror]
   24 |         if (ftrace_trace_function != ftrace_stub)
      |                                   ^~

--- a/arch/nds32/kernel/ftrace.c
+++ b/arch/nds32/kernel/ftrace.c
@@ -6,7 +6,7 @@
 
 #ifndef CONFIG_DYNAMIC_FTRACE
 extern void (*ftrace_trace_function)(unsigned long, unsigned long,
-				     struct ftrace_ops*, struct pt_regs*);
+				     struct ftrace_ops*, struct ftrace_regs*);
 extern void ftrace_graph_caller(void);
 
 noinline void __naked ftrace_stub(unsigned long ip, unsigned long parent_ip,
